Smile Looking at an 08 Casita Freedom Deluxe

Good morning, my name is Greg and my wife and I are currently looking for a gently used Casita Deluxe. We are keeping an eye on a 2008 Freedom Deluxe currently for sale about 3/12 hours from us, and are hoping to go see it this weekend. I know that with the captains chairs found in this model that you lose some storage under the seats, and with storage being a premium on these campers, was wondering if anyone on here has bought this layout and found that to be a big issue. Or if there was anything else about this particular layout that you did not like. Thanks for any info you can share.

Hi Greg and Teresa,

Welcome. We had a Freedom for 8 years and loved it. We thougt it was the best Casita design. Having captains chairs in such a small trailer is a real bonus. Gives you a comfortable place inside to hang out. The under bench storage in the Spirit is really minimal and we found the space under the chairs to be pretty flexible (ie: Dave's camera bag would fit under the chairs but not under the Spirit benches.) Since we are retired now and traveling more we wanted a little more space and along came Reace and Tammie with the Escape 21, the rest is history.

Good luck - go for it!

I have a Freedom 2014 and wouldn't consider any other model😊
The Spirit is the best seller because you can convert the dinette to a bed...if you have kids, that's what you need, or a Liberty,etc.
If you're traveling solo or as a couple, the Freedom chairs are the way to go.
There are numerous posts on Spirit owners modifying the dinette seats to make them more comfortable. With the captain's chairs, years of kickback comfort are ahead for you.
You can buy,which I did, boat sliders to scoot the chairs back a bit to provide more aisle clearance. You can do a search on the casita forum for where to purchase them, think I got mine on Amazon. We can tuck items, bags etc, around the chairs without having to open those lower doors, a pain for us.
Also, the 2008 model is when they upgraded the fabric. I believe you also have the polar bear a.c., while the new models are struggling with the Mach 8 and its tribulations.
Some people also like the bathroom layout better on the older models as well.
I had to buy new because there wasn't a Freedom model in my area, they are just so rare. 3 and 1/2 hrs away? Incredible luck! Do it!
